Apart from Chrysalis and her implied bloodlust, there really was not much to say about this episode.

Mean 6 themselves were good on paper, bad in practice, because they offed themselves at the climax of the episode, so were a non threat, since all they did was annoy Chrysalis and become disobedient, which I do admit was funny, but besides this, where is the action? Mane Six did not really have to worry about them because they did not even know what was happening, and at the end of the episode it was already too late as Mean Six had died, Chrysalis had lost her foot-soldiers before the war even began.

a villain without the drama in the story is a joke, the most generous I can give this, is mediocre, 5/10.

Queen Chrysalis definitely is a sad case, she makes no effort to redeem, no effort to make amends for the hurt she has caused, even after being shown a non violent way to survive she pursues aggression toward Ponies in Equestria, it is a mature message but not one inappropriate for younger audiences. Starlight Glimmer did try to reason with her in To Where and Back Again, she did try to make Chrysalis see that her own lack of wisdom was causing her downfall, instead of being a true leader for her subjects and bring a sustainable future to herself and them, she chose a path of failure. Mean 6 episode did show this much about her character, losing her subjects was her own fault and in the end her villainy caught up with her, leading to her petrification in season 9.
